The blue-and-yellow can is getting more profitable, but shareholders aren't seeing the cash.

In this episode, Susie and Miro dissect a perplexing Q1 2026 for WD-40 Company. Gross margins jumped to an impressive 56.2%—driven by the "premiumization" of the Smart Straw—yet Net Income actually dropped 8%. How does that math work?

We break down the massive spike in the "Cost of Doing Business" that spooked the market, the sudden 33% collapse in Asia distributor sales, and why the company is actively trying to sell off its household cleaning brands (goodbye, 2000 Flushes).
